Hierarchical Model Composition

Model composition refers to the ability to include models as submodels inside other models. This requires defining the interfaces between the models and rules for connecting parts of models together. The motivation is to enable the creation of standard, vetted models and use them as library components when creating larger models, much as is done in software development, electronics design, and other engineering fields.

Active proposals

The SBML Development Process for SBML Level 3 involves two stages: a proposal stage, and a specification development stage. All SBML Level 3 activities are currently in the proposal stage. The following is a list of the active proposals for hierarchical model composition in SBML Level 3:

  1. Hierarchical Model Composition proposal by Hoops et al. (2007)

